A chemist must dilute 28.6 mL of 801. mM aqueous aluminum sulfate (Al₂(SO4)3) solution until the concentration falls to 183. mM . He'll do this by adding distilled water to the solution until it reaches a certain final volume. Calculate this final volume, in liters. Round your answer to 3 significant digits. 0 x10 X S ?
